上一個主題: 使用篩選器縮小搜尋範圍下一個主題: 在多個受監控裝置上設定介面與元件的別名


為多個受監控裝置設定別名名稱

CA Performance Center 包含一個指令檔來設定多個受監控裝置的別名。 您可以使用這個指令檔,一次設定多個受監控裝置的別名。 這些別名會出現在裝置清查清單和介面清查清單中。

注意:使用此指令碼所設定的別名,其優先順序高於新增 IP 網域時透過匯入 CSV 檔案所設定的別名。 如需匯入 CSV 檔案的詳細資訊,請參閱《CA Performance Center 管理員指南》。

這個指令檔有兩個函數。 第一,指令檔傳回一份裝置項目 ID 與裝置名稱的清單,格式為 .csv。 您可以修改 .csv 檔,加入您要在每個監控裝置上設定的別名名稱。 指令檔的第二個函數是抓取更新的 .csv 檔並為監控的裝置設定別名名稱。

請依循下列步驟:

  1. 開啟命令提示字元並存取 Performance_Center_installation_directory/PerformanceCenter/Tools/bin 目錄。
  2. 若要呼叫指令檔為監控的裝置設定別名名稱,請輸入下列命令:
    ./update_alias_name.sh
    

    已詳列指令檔參數並提供說明。

  3. 若要傳回一份受監控裝置的完整清單,請輸入下列命令:
    ./update_alias_name.sh -h host_name -u username -p password [-T item_type] [-o output_filename]
    
    -h host_name

    指定要連線的 CA Performance Center 主機名稱。

    -u username

    指定將設定別名的 CA Performance Center 管理員使用者名稱。

    -p password

    指定將設定別名的 CA Performance Center 管理員密碼。

    -T item_type

    指定您要為其設定別名的項目類型。 有效值為裝置、介面,或元件。

    預設:裝置

    請保留預設值。

    -o output_filename

    (選用) 建立一個 .csv 檔,包含監控裝置的總數 (按項目 ID 與裝置名稱),將 .csv 檔命名為與預設檔名不同的檔案名稱。 若您未替這個參數輸入值,將以預設的名稱 DeviceList.csv 做為 .csv 檔的檔名。

    .csv 檔具備以下格式:裝置項目 ID, 裝置名稱。

    例如:

    560, MyRouter1

    561, MyRouter2

  4. 修改上個步驟中建立的 .csv 檔,記下您要為每個監控裝置設定的別名名稱。 這個檔案必須採用下列格式:裝置項目 ID, 裝置別名。

    附註:若您的 .csv 檔中的項目 ID 無效,將不會顯示錯誤訊息。 無效的項目將被略過。

    例如:

    560, MyRouter1AliasDisplayName

    561, MyRouter2AliasDisplayName

    附註:.csv 檔的 [別名] 欄位可以使用逗號與空格。

  5. 輸入下列命令:
    ./update_alias_name.sh -h host_name -u username -p password [-T device] -i input_file 
    
    -i input_file

    指定您先前所建立包含別名名稱的 .csv 檔的檔名。

    監控裝置的別名名稱即完成設定。

    注意:如果未指定 -i,則指令碼會查閱所指定類型所需的所有項目 ID,並建立含項目 ID 和項目名稱的 csv 檔案。

  6. (選用) 若要為大量的受監控裝置設定別名,請輸入下列命令以調整批次大小並於批次間暫停。 這些調整有助於控制工作量:
    ./update_alias_name.sh -h host_name -u username -p password -T device -i input_file -b batch_size –t time_in_seconds
    
    –b batch_size

    指出每個批次中要處理的項目數。

    預設值:10000

    如果未指定 -i 參數,則為預設值:150

    –t time_in_seconds

    指出批次之間要暫停的時間 (以秒為單位)。

    預設值:1

    如果未指定 -i 參數,則為預設值:1

    例如:

    ./update_alias_name.sh -h host_name -u username -p password -T device -i input_file -b 20 –t 2
    

更多資訊:

新增 IP 網域